Hi all,

We are currently trying to use a PC with 2 x Radeon cards on Debian Squeeze
using a backports 2.6.39 kernel to drive 3 large display monitors in our
support centre. Unfortunately we are currently unable to drive both cards at
the same time using two different X server processes. As discussed previously
on the xorg mailing list (see
http://lists.freedesktop.org/archives/xorg/2011-August/053467.html), this
appears to be a radeon driver-specific issue since if we switch one of the
monitors over to the internal Intel graphics card then all is well.

Attached to this bug report are the outputs from launching both X servers and
other information I hope will be useful in order to help someone find the
issue.

Currently the two X sessions are launched in separate terminals like this:

X :0 -isolateDevice 'PCI:1:0:0' -config /root/debug/xorg.2.conf
X :1 -isolateDevice 'PCI:2:0:0' -config /root/debug/xorg.1.conf

When both are launched together, only the 'PCI:1:0:0' display appears to be
enabled - the second 'PCI:2:0:0' currently remains off in power-save mode.
